Alan and I had written draft-richardson-emu-eap-onboarding back in 2022, which
was about defining a useful thing to do EAP-TLS *without* a client certificate.
That used [email protected].
Alan then decided that defining @eap.arpa first would be a good idea.
And I think that document is now past WGLC, and so maybe it's time to resume
work on emu-eap-onboarding. I would be happy to update it based upon eap-arpa
changes before the deadline.
